#664At Exnaton, we build software for renewable energy communities and energy sharing. Our software processes energy data from smart meters in households and does high resolution tariffing and billing of energy flows. We sell it in a SaaS model to utility companies, so they can offer their customers attractive products around distributed renewable energy generation. We are a seed stage company, spun off of ETH Zurich, are currently a team of 12, and have raised our first funding round with Global Founders Capital.
We operate a stack with a backend built in a strict micro-services pattern with polyglot services written in Python and TypeScript. Technologies are chosen to fit the purpose (e.g. time series, relational, no-sql databases). All deployments rely on Helm and run on platform-agnostic Kubernetes clusters. Our frontend is a Vue SPA (TypeScript) with a continuously extending feature set.

#670Intruder is a SaaS platform that helps companies easily identify their cyber security weaknesses, and fix them, before they get hacked. We're a fast growing startup, over 2000 customers from around the world love our product.
Tech stack: Ruby on Rails and Python/Django back-end apps. Celery/RabbitMQ for orchestrating background jobs like scanning for vulnerabilities. Vue.js front-end. Many 3rd party API integrations. Mostly hosted on Kubernetes.
Although our company base is London (a nice office in a WeWork in Shoreditch), we have team members located around the globe and our dev team is remote first. We'll consider remote applications for this role as long as you're within 2 hours of the GMT timezone.
